A Dallas police officer was kept on the job for more than a year while authorities investigated if he ordered the killings of 2 people, officials say.

that detectives with the Dallas Police Department recommended not placing Riser on administrative leave"because it could possibly compromise the case."

Her remarks followed Riser's arrest on Thursday. He has been charged with two counts of capital murder in the killings of Lisa Saenz, 31, who was found shot dead in the Trinity River in March 2017, and ofRiser was being held Friday on $5 million bond after a court appearance Thursday night. Court records don’t list an attorney for Riser, who told the court he would hire one.

When Riser was first identified as a person of interest, police working alongside the Dallas County District Attorney’s Office determined there wasn’t yet enough evidence to charge him, Hall said. Eddie Garcia, who became chief last month, said a witness told police in 2019 that they kidnapped and killed Saenz and Douglas on Riser’s instructions in separate 2017 attacks., Garcia said the two murders were connected to Riser's"off-duty" life, adding that they"will be looking at the activity he conducted as a police officer," including his arrest record.

Garcia didn’t elaborate on why Riser was arrested nearly 20 months after the witness came forward, and police declined to answer subsequent questions about the timing.
